JAIPUR: Four motorcycle-borne armed robbers on Wednesday looted over Rs two lakh in cash from a cashier of the Oriental Bank of Commerce at gun point in Hanumangarh district.
    
Robbers pushed every one behind to enter the bank's branch located at Nagrana village in the district around 1400 hrs, Sangaria SHO Pratapmal Kedia said.    

The robbers fled from the spot on two motorcycles after getting the cash, Kedia said.
    
All entry and exit points to the district were alerted and a search operation has been launched to nab the robbers, he said.
